Detailed

In summary, energy resources are integral to human development, powering homes, industries, and transportation. However, their overuse and mismanagement have led to serious environmental challenges, such as pollution and climate change, primarily linked to non-renewable sources like fossil fuels. While renewable energy options like solar and wind present cleaner alternatives, they come with certain limitations. As such, it is crucial to adopt practices that enhance energy efficiency, promote conservation, and utilize innovations and robust policy frameworks to foster a sustainable energy future. Collaboration among individuals, communities, and governments is essential to ensure equitable and eco-friendly access to energy.

Current State of Energy Consumption

Unlock Audio Book

Signup and Enroll to the course for listening the Audio Book

Non-renewable sources like coal and oil dominate global consumption, but contribute heavily to pollution and climate change.

Detailed Explanation

Currently, most countries rely heavily on non-renewable sources of energy, such as coal and oil. These sources are limited and will eventually run out. Moreover, their combustion releases harmful gases that pollute the air, contributing to climate change through the greenhouse effect. This situation creates urgent challenges to find cleaner and more sustainable energy solutions.

Examples & Analogies

Think of driving a car that runs on gasoline. If you drive it non-stop without considering where you will refuel or the exhaust fumes being released, it will not only run out of fuel but also create pollution in the environment. We need to find ways to drive cleaner or consider using electric cars instead.

Renewable Energy Alternatives

Unlock Audio Book

Signup and Enroll to the course for listening the Audio Book

Renewable sources such as solar and wind offer cleaner alternatives, although they come with their own limitations.

Detailed Explanation

Renewable energy sources, like solar and wind, are being increasingly recognized as cleaner alternatives to fossil fuels. These sources are renewable, meaning they won't run out in our lifetimes. However, they still face challenges, such as the inconsistency of sunlight and wind, which can make energy supply unpredictable. Itโ€™s essential to continue researching and investing in these technologies to optimize their use.

Examples & Analogies

Consider a solar-powered calculator. When you leave it in the sun, it works brilliantly, but when you take it indoors, it stops functioning. This shows how renewable energy, like solar power, depends on specific conditions, emphasizing the need for more reliable solutions.

Glossary of Terms

Review the Definitions for terms.

  • Term: Energy Resources

    Definition:

    Sources of energy that are used to power human activities, including renewable and non-renewable sources.

  • Term: NonRenewable Energy

    Definition:

    Energy sources that are finite and cannot be replenished in a human timescale, such as fossil fuels.

  • Term: Renewable Energy

    Definition:

    Energy sources that are naturally replenished, such as solar and wind energy.

  • Term: Energy Conservation

    Definition:

    The practice of using less energy to reduce consumption and preserve resources.

  • Term: Sustainability

    Definition:

    Meeting the needs of the present without compromising the ability of future generations to meet their own needs.
